Humans were able to jump higher on the moon due to its lower gravity compared to Earth. The moon's gravity is about one-sixth that of Earth, allowing for greater mobility and height in jumps.
The force of gravity is greatest between two masses whose product is greatest, and which are closest together. You're already as close to the earth's total mass as you can get, and there's nothing you can do to change the earth's mass. So the only way to increase the mutual force of gravity between the earth and another body is to increase the mass of the secondary body. In fewer words: Eat more. Get heavier.

Humans will feel lighter on Mars compared to Earth because Mars has less gravity. The gravity on Mars is about 38% of Earth's gravity, so a person who weighs 100 pounds on Earth would weigh only 38 pounds on Mars.

Earth's gravity is a force that pulls objects towards its center. It gives weight to objects and keeps the Moon in orbit around the Earth. The strength of Earth's gravity decreases with distance from its center.
